    Thank you so much for making this tutorial! I spent 2 hours this morning trying to rethread the lower loop after a needle broke on a 3 minute job. The instruction manual isn’t easy to navigate and the information you gave about the threader (which is very confusing in the manual when you don’t know what they are talking about!) really helped to demystify the pictures on page 32. Also, following your tutorial I realised the order of threading is important as I had rethreaded the lower loop correctly, but couldn’t understand why the thread broke each time I started using it. Thank you also for explaining about how much easier it is to thread when you lower the blade and remove the foot.     Thanks for great video. I am able to thread the hidden guides for the lower looper reasonably well, but frequently have an issue with one or both loopers coming unthreaded once I run with the new thread. Is there a specific way that the lower looper thread has to go in relation to the upper looper thread as this is all I can think, but I do thread in the correct order and pull the first thread under the foot and to the left side before threading the upper looper? Thanks.

    • @AbisDen
      @AbisDen  Před 3 lety +1

      Hey Judith. When you thread the machine, be sure to make sure all threads are coming through freely and not entangled with each other. That should hopefully be all that’s needed

    Hi Abi! Thanks so much for the tutorial. For some reason my lower looper on this machine keeps coming unthreaded and I don’t know what to do 😭 have you got any tips?

    • @AbisDen
      @AbisDen  Před 3 lety +1

      💕 Clean the machine and thread it in the correct order. The lower looper thread should be through all of the guides properly and securely or they slip out easily and unthread the machine. 👍🏽
